What Are Service Charges?

Service charges are recurring fees paid by homeowners to cover the upkeep and management of their residential building or community. They typically include:

  • Cleaning and general maintenance
  • Security services
  • Landscaping
  • Waste disposal
  • Repairs and building upkeep
  • Management and administration
  • Utilities, including DEWA

These charges apply to all property types in Dubai, residential or commercial, apartments or villas. The total amount depends on your property type and the services included in your service contract.

How Much Do Service Charges Cost?

The Dubai Land Department (DLD) provides a Service Charge Index to help homeowners understand approved fees across different communities.

Service charges are usually calculated per square foot, with prices ranging from AED 3 to AED 30 or more per square foot, depending on the property type and services provided. Common inclusions are security staff, cleaning, landscaping, and general maintenance.

Why Service Charges Vary

Service charges in Dubai are not uniform. The fee you pay depends on several factors:

  • Property type: Villas generally have higher fees than apartments due to larger areas and gardens.
  • Amenities offered: Communities with gyms, pools, parks, or private security often have higher service charges.
  • Property management standards: Premium communities or established developers maintain higher standards, reflected in higher fees.

How to Find the Service Charge for a Property

The DLD Service Charge Index allows homeowners to check fees online or via the Dubai REST app. Payments can be made through the Mollak service, which deposits fees directly into DLD-approved bank accounts.

Step-by-Step Guide to Check Service Charges:

  1. Visit the DLD Service Charge Index: dubailand.gov.ae
  2. Click Access this service
  3. Enter the required details:
    • Certificate number or title deed number
    • Year of certificate issuance
    • Property type
    • Year for which you want the service charge information
  4. Verify yourself and complete the captcha
  5. Click Calculate

You can also use the locator map to see the property management company and get a breakdown of the fees.

Dubai Real Estate Market Review 21-Aug-2026

Dubai’s real estate market recorded AED1,307.91 million in transactions on 20 August 2026. Ready properties generated AED658.96 million, contributing 50.4% of total value, while off-plan properties accounted for AED648.95 million, or 49.6%. Ready-market activity exceeded off-plan sales by approximately AED10.01 million, reflecting an almost evenly balanced session between the two segments. Land transactions reached AED625.43 million during the day.
